> Add and ACPI idle power level limit for 32-bit ThinkPad T40.
>
> There is a regression on T40 introduced by commit d6b88ce2, starting with kernel 5.16:
>
> commit d6b88ce2eb9d2698eb24451eb92c0a1649b17bb1
> Author: Richard Gong <richard.gong@xxxxxxx>
> Date:   Wed Sep 22 08:31:16 2021 -0500
>
>     ACPI: processor idle: Allow playing dead in C3 state
>
> The above patch is trying to enter C3 state during init, what is causing a T40 system freeze. I have not found a similar issue on any other of my 32-bit machines.
>
> The fix is to add another exception to the processor_power_dmi_table[] list.
> As a result the dmesg shows as expected:
>
>     2.155398] ACPI: IBM ThinkPad T40 detected - limiting to C2 max_cstate. Override with "processor.max_cstate=9"
> [    2.155404] ACPI: processor limited to max C-state 2
>
> The fix is trivial and affects only vintage T40 systems.
